Abstract: Objective To explore the correlation between workplace stress,feedback and job burnout among nurses in hemodialysis rooms of five general hospitals in Hainan Province. Methods From December 2022 to February 2023,a convenient sampling method was used to select 182 nurses from the hemodialysis rooms of five general hospitals in Hainan Province as the survey subjects. The workplace stress scale,feedback scale,and occupational burnout scale were used for the investigation,and the data were analyzed. Results The workplace stress score of 182 hemodialysis room nurses was(93.62±15.38)points,the feedback score was (61.36±8.84)points,and the occupational burnout score was (59.81±8.72)points. The age,professional title,working years,and night shift frequency were the factors affecting workplace stress among nurses(P<0.05). The age,professional title,working years,marital status,monthly income and night shift frequency were the factors affecting feedback level of nurses(P<0.05). The age,professional title,working years,monthly income and night shift frequency were the factors affecting occupational burnout among nurses(P<0.05). There was a positive correlation between workplace stress and job burnout among nurses in the hemodialysis room(r=0.635,P<0.01),a negative correlation between feedback and job burnout(r=-0.546,P<0.01),and a negative correlation between workplace stress and feedback(r=-0.529,P<0.01). The feedback of nurses in hemodialysis room had a mediating effect between workplace stress and job burnout,with the mesomeric effect of 0.209,accounting for 37.93% of the total effect. Conclusion The feedback among nurses in the hemodialysis room of five general hospitals in Hainan Province is closely related to workplace stress and job burnout,and plays a partial mediating role between workplace stress and job burnout.
